Description

Job Opportunity: Interventional Radiology Registered Nurse (Travel/Contract)

Location: New Port Richey, Florida
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Position Summary

Seeking a Registered Nurse with experience in Diagnostic and Interventional Cardiac Cath Lab and Interventional Radiology procedures. This is a travel/contract position in a short-term acute care facility.


Required Experience & Skills

  • Specialty: Registered Nurse - Cath Lab / Interventional Radiology
  • Years of Experience Required: 2 years (highest requirement)
  • First-timers Accepted: Yes
  • Prior Travel Experience: Not explicitly required
  • Certifications Required:
    • ACLS (AHA or RQI accepted)
    • BLS (AHA or RQI accepted)
  • On-Call Requirement: Yes
  • Floating: No floating outside scope of practice
  • Experience Required:
    • Diagnostic Cardiac Cath Lab
    • Interventional Cardiac Cath Lab
    • Interventional Radiology
    • Special Procedures work setting
    • Experience with On-Call procedures including Impella, IABP, EKOS, CSI, Jetstream, Laser, Shockwave
  • EMR System: Cerner

Unit Details

  • Diagnostic Cath
  • PCI (Percutaneous Coronary Intervention)
  • Peripheral Vascular
  • PPM (Permanent Pacemaker) Implants
  • Interventional Radiology Procedures

Facility Type

  • Short Term Acute Care
  • Total Staffed Beds: 222

Licensure & Compliance

  • Licensure: Florida RN license required (pending licenses not accepted)
  • Driver’s License: Must be current and active throughout assignment
  • Background Checks: Standard background checks including SS trace, county searches, nationwide, sex offender, education verification, EPLS/GSA/SAM, HHS/OIG
  • Fingerprinting: Florida AHCA Level II fingerprint clearance required prior to start
  • Education Verification: Required for all healthcare professionals
  • References: 2 references from past 2 years required
  • Employment Application & Skills Checklist: Required

Health & Safety Requirements

  • Physical exam within 6 months of start
  • Negative TB test or chest X-ray within 10 weeks of start
  • Annual TB questionnaire required
  • Immunizations or titers required for:
    • Rubeola (Measles)
    • Mumps
    • Rubella
    • Hepatitis B (titer, series, or declination)
    • Varicella
  • Drug testing: Standard 9-panel within 30 days (instant tests not accepted)
  • Seasonal Flu Vaccination or documented declination (mask required if declined)
  • COVID-19 vaccination required (medical/religious exemptions accepted)
  • Respirator medical clearance if respirator use is required

Competency & Training Requirements

  • Medication/Pharmacology competency exam (score ≥ 80%)
  • Dysrhythmia/EKG competency exam (100% lethal arrhythmia score required)
  • Color Blind Testing (Relias) prior to start
  • Crisis Prevention Institute (CPI) certification if applicable
  • Stroke Education CEUs (8 total credits required for certain units)
  • NIH Stroke Certification and mRS (Modified Rankin Scale) certification as applicable
  • BayCare Online Learning Center modules must be completed prior to start (4-8 hours)

Additional Notes

  • Locals are not accepted for this travel position
  • No guaranteed hours until after first call off per pay period
  • COVID-19 vaccination required, but exemptions accepted for medical or religious reasons
  • Clear, professional photo required for badge prior to start
  • Dress code and tobacco policy compliance required

This position is ideal for a Registered Nurse with Cath Lab and Interventional Radiology experience looking for a travel contract in Florida. The role requires strong clinical skills, certification compliance, and the ability to work on-call with specialized cardiac and radiology equipment.
